Q: Is 453,178,234 a Prime Number?
A: No, 453,178,234 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 453178234 can be evenly divided by 1 2 19 38 11,925,743 23,851,486 226,589,117 and 453,178,234, with no remainder.
Since 453,178,234 cannot be divided by just 1 and 453,178,234, it is not a prime number.
